The Use of D in Chemical Formulas

In chemistry, the letter D can be used in various ways to symbolize different things. One of these is in chemical formulas, where it represents deuterium, one of the isotopes of hydrogen. Deuterium differs from ordinary hydrogen in that it contains a neutron in its nucleus, in addition to a proton and an electron. This makes it slightly heavier than ordinary hydrogen.

  • Deuterium is often represented by the symbol D in chemical formulas, where it can appear as either D or 2H.
  • In organic chemistry, deuterium can be used as a tracer to study reaction mechanisms and molecular kinetics.
  • Deuterium-labeled compounds can also be used in drug development to study drug metabolism and clearance.

One of the most common uses of deuterium in chemistry is in the synthesis of deuterated solvents. These are solvents where hydrogen atoms have been replaced with deuterium atoms. Deuterated solvents are useful in NMR spectroscopy as they produce separate peaks for different types of protons in a molecule, making it easier to identify the chemical structure.

The table below shows some common deuterated solvents and their chemical formulas:

Solvent Formula
Deuterium oxide D2O
Deuterated chloroform CDCl3
Deuterated methanol CD3OD
